Metallography Principles of Metallography, Vol. 1 reveals how metals hide their true structure and how to see it.
This foundational text explains the general principles of metallography and the methods used in a metallographic laboratory to study metals and their alloys. Drawn from a university lecture course, it lays out the theory of constitution, phase diagrams, and practical techniques for preparing, observing, and interpreting metal microstructures.
Readers will gain a clear, step‑by‑step view of how metallography connects theory with laboratory practice. Topics range from the phase rule and constitution diagrams to the preparation of metallic alloys, microscopy, etching, and the interpretation of microstructures in pure metals and binary systems. The book also introduces thermal analysis, pyrometry, and the mechanical properties that relate structure to performance, all with the goal of applying metallographic findings to engineering and industry.
